skyline读取适量文件属性

featurelayer = sgworld.Creator.CreateFeatureLayer("longjingguoji","FileName=D:\\data\\longjingguoji.shp;TEPlugName=OGR;","");
        featurelayer.Streaming = false;
        featurelayer.Refresh();
        var features = featurelayer.FeatureGroups.Polygon.Features;
        for(var i=0; i < features.Count; i++){
            var featuree = features.Item(i);
            var geometryy = featuree.Geometry;
            console.log(geometryy);
            var attribute = featuree.FeatureAttributes;
            console.log(attribute);
            console.log(attribute.Count);
            break;
        }

注意:  加载方式与流方式和层方式有关

             如果为流方式,如果当前视图下没有加载, 是获取不到属性信息的

转载自:https://blog.csdn.net/wt346326775/article/details/56479785

You may also like...

退出移动版